The stages of follicle development into the correct order is
1. Primordial follicle
2. Primary follicle
3. Secondary follicle
4. Mature follicle
5. Corpus Iuteum
6. Corpus albicans
The three stages of preantral follicular development are activation of primordial follicles, the change from primary to secondary follicles, and the progression of secondary follicles to the perinatal stage.
One follicle is chosen and develops to maturity each month. When this follicle reaches the proper size and maturity, it bursts, releasing the egg, which is now prepared for fertilization. This usually occurs 14 days or so after the start of the menstrual cycle.
